Nope, i'm just running SH3 without any mods. The VIIC/42 comes with the original game (?)

See also this website (http://www.giantbomb.com/silent-hunter-iii/3030-11923/):
Quote:
Playable U-Boats
  • Type II A
  • Type II D
  • Type VII B
  • Type VII C
  • Type VII C/41
  • Type VII C/42
  • Type IX B
  • Type IX C
  • Type IX C/40
  • Type IX D2
  • Type XXI
My guess is that the VIIC/41 and VIIC/42 are based on the VIIC model and that they are pretty much al the same? So any changes to the orginal VIIC will effect the 42, am I right?

Based on how damage zones are set up for any given ship? Turning turtle can be seen. Most stock Units rarely do that. Mods that have had extensive changes to the damages will do it more often but not often enuff to make it unreal.
